[/align][align=center]Each year, the American Kennel Club registers more than a million purebred dogs of 150 breeds and varieties of dogs. The United Kennel Club registers more than 200 breeds, and worldwide, about 400 breeds are recognized, yet most of the dogs in the world are at least a mixture of two breeds and often a multi-breed combination like the famous 57 varieties of Heinz products.[/align][align=center][/align][align=center][/align][align=center][/align][align=center]Click below for more infor[/align][align=center][:-][/align][align=center]http://www.canismajor.com/dog/mixed.html[/align][align=center][/align]
